The written pattern you may find below:

Part 1: Heart of Sunflower

R1. Start with a magic ring. Add 4 single crochet. Close with a slip stitch.

R2. Make 1 single crochet, then add 12 double crochet in the center. Close the row with a slip stitch. Close the piece and cut off the yarn. Pull the yarn to make it tight in the center.

Part 2: Sunflower Petals

R1. Start by adding 3 single crochet. Make a puffy stitch with 3 triple (TREBLE) crochet. Meaning make three triple crochets, but close it by pulling the 4th loop through all of the rest of the loops. Add 2 single crochet. The next petal is a puffy stitch made from 4 triple crochet. Make 12 petals.

Part 3: Sunflower Border

Attach white yarn by making one single crochet, and add 3 double crochet.

First Side. Add 3 triple crochet. Chain 2 single crochet. Add three triple crochet. Add 3 double crochet. Add another 3 double crochet.

Second Side. Add 3 triple crochet. Chain 2 single crochet. Add 3 triple crochet. Add 3 double crochet and another 3 double crochet.

Third Side. Make again 3 triple crochet, chain 2 single crochet, and then another 3 triple crochet. Add three double crochet and then another 3 double crochet.

Fourth Side. Make a triple crochet and then chain two, and make three double crochet. Add two double crochet. Close the row with a slip stitch.

Make one single crochet and continue with a double crochet until the corner. On the corners make 2 double crochet and chain 2 and add another 2 double crochet for the corner. After continue with only one double crochet. Close the row with the slip stitch.✂

The tools used in the video:

Hook 3mm
Scissors ✂
Alize gold yarn
